This automation block allows you to import a single email message from Outlook into an item's updates based on the Message ID.
The standard use case for this automation block is the third part of the following sentences:
- When an email is received in Outlook, create an item, and add the email into the item's updates
- When status changes, send an email with Outlook, and add the email into the item's updates
How it works
For automations
This is normally a 2 or 3 step process.
For example:
- Add a trigger, e.g.
- When status changes to something - if the Email Message ID is already populated in a column
- Add the action – Import email message into update • Outlook – this automation block

Or:
- Add a trigger, e.g.
- When email received in Outlook – provided by monday.com - emits Message ID – the Email Message ID needs to be populated in a column for later use
- Add the action – Create item – provided by monday.com
- Add the action – Import email message into update • Outlook – this automation block
In the last step above, fill out the various fields. Use the Message ID (saved to a column) from step 1 in the Email Message ID field.
For workflows
This is normally a 3 step process
- Add the trigger – When email received in Outlook – provided by monday.com - emits Message ID
- Add the action – Create item – provided by monday.com
- Add the action – Import email message into update • Outlook – this automation block
In step 3 above, fill out the various fields. Use the Message ID from step 1 in the Email Message ID field:

Key benefits
- Exact dates and times of the original email is retained in the update
- Emails from private mailboxes can be shared team-wide
- Imported email persist in the update even after team members depart
